Dental impression disinfectant spray12/11/2023 ![]() Disinfection with sodium hypochlorite was associated with clinically significant changes in dimensions, with a two-tailed p-value of 0.049. Immersion in the chemical disinfectant for 10 min was associated with clinically irrelevant changes in the dimensions of the PVES impressions. Results and conclusionĭental impressions made from the PVES elastomeric impression materials showed no significant changes in dimensional stability. Heterogeneity among studies was measured using the Cochrane Q and I 2. The effect size was calculated using Hedge’s g values at the 95% confidence level using the random-effects model. The primary data were retrieved, and batch exported from databases using Harzing’s Publish or Perish software primary analysis was performed in Microsoft Excel, while statistical analysis for effect size, two-tailed p-values, and heterogeneity among studies was performed using Meta Essentials. The PRISMA (Preferred Reporting Items for Systemic Review and Meta-Analysis) directions were observed during the data collection, screening of studies, and meta-analysis. ![]() The data was collected from research studies retrieved from Google Scholar, Scopus, and PubMed using MeSH terms of keywords “vinyl polyether siloxane AND Disinfection” or (Vinyl polyether siloxane OR polyvinyl siloxane ether OR PVES) AND (disinfectant OR disinfection)” without any restriction to publication date. This study was aimed to understand the PVES behavior when subjected to chemical disinfectants. ![]() As recommended use of chemical disinfecting agents is getting more popular, there is a growing concern associated with the effect of disinfectants on PVES dimensional stability. PVES dimensional stability owes to its better polymeric properties derived from its parent materials poly ethers and polyvinyl siloxanes. The compound disinfectant spray with trichioro hydroxyl diphenyl ether is an effective antiseptics for alginate impressions and plaster models.Polyvinyl ether siloxane (PVES) possesses ideal characteristics for making precise and accurate dental impressions. ![]() The disinfectant spray with tame concentration was more effective on the alginate impression than on the plaster model in the same time (P = 0.000). The compound disinfectant spray with 3000 mg x L(-1) triebloro hydroxyl diphenyl ether was effective to all tested pathogens for 10 mm whatever on the impressions or the plaster models. The colonies were counted after sampling, inoculate and culture, which were used to deduce the killing logarithm value as the standard of the disinfecting efficiency. The disinfection efficiency of a compound disinfectant spray with trichioro hydroxyl diphenyl ether on dental impression and plaster model, which have been contaminated by pathogens, were evaluated in this study.Īs experimental group, germ-free alginate impressions and plaster models were sprayed with the compound disinfectant of different density trichloro hydroxyl diphenyl ether or indophors for 5, 10 and is mm, after which were smeared with five tested pathogens, including Staphylococcus acre us, Escherichia cali, Saccharomyces albicans, Streptococcus mutans and black spore variants of Bacillus subtilis. ![]()
